Food delivery apps in China faced a backlash after a report went viral showing tough conditions for delivery riders working for Ele.me and Meituan, the two biggest delivery apps. The report, first published in Chinese magazine Renwu and seen more than 1 million times, according to the South China Morning Post, detailed how drivers risked their lives to meet tight deadlines.
